What is Lymphedema?
Lymphedema is a type of chronic swelling caused by a buildup of fluid in the tissues. Unlike general edema, which is temporary, lymphedema persists over time. It often occurs when the lymphatic system is damaged or blocked, preventing proper fluid drainage.
In individuals with spinal cord injuries, paralyzed leg muscles lose their ability to pump fluids effectively. This results in a daily loss of about 3 liters of fluid movement, leading to dependent edema in the legs.
Why Paraplegia Increases the Risk of Lymphedema
Paralyzed muscles reduce venous return by 70%, making it harder for the body to circulate fluids. Additionally, the sitting position of wheelchair users increases gravitational pull on fluids, causing them to pool in the legs. Studies show that gravity can triple fluid accumulation in the legs of wheelchair users.
A common diagnostic method is the pitting edema test. In 89% of cases involving spinal cord injuries, pressing on the swollen area leaves an indentation deeper than 5mm.

Compression Stockings: How They Help
Compression stockings are a popular solution for reducing swelling. These specially designed garments apply gentle pressure to the legs, promoting better circulation. Studies show that medical-grade gradient compression stockings (30-40mmHg) can reduce swelling by up to 58%. lymphedema management paraplegia
When choosing compression stockings, consider the level of pressure. Options range from 20-30mmHg for mild swelling to 30-40mmHg for more severe cases. Always wear compression stockings as directed and check for proper fit to avoid skin irritation.
Leg Elevation: Simple Yet Effective
Elevating your legs is a straightforward way to reduce fluid buildup. Raising your legs at a 20° angle can drain up to 300ml of fluid per hour. For wheelchair users, tilting the chair can achieve a similar effect.
Try elevating your legs for 30 minutes, four times a day. This simple habit can make a significant difference in managing swelling and improving comfort.
Exercise and Movement: Keeping Fluids Moving
Regular movement is essential for maintaining healthy circulation. Functional Electrical Stimulation (FES) cycling, for example, improves blood flow by 120% compared to passive movement. Aim for 15-minute sessions, three times a week.
Even small movements, like ankle rotations or seated stretches, can help. Staying active ensures fluids don’t pool in the legs, reducing the risk of swelling.

Reducing Sodium Intake
lymphedema management paraplegia High sodium levels can worsen fluid retention. Cutting just 5g of sodium daily can reduce leg volume by 18%. Aim for less than 2,300mg of sodium per day, especially if you have a spinal cord injury.
Replace salty snacks with high-potassium alternatives like bananas, spinach, and coconut water. These foods help balance fluids in the body and reduce swelling naturally.
Importance of Hydration
Staying hydrated is essential for fluid balance. Drink water regularly, aiming for 35ml per kilogram of body weight each day. Proper hydration helps your body process fluids more efficiently.
Monitor hydration levels using urine color charts. Light yellow indicates good hydration, while dark yellow suggests you need to drink water. Avoid diuretic beverages like alcohol and coffee, as they can dehydrate you.

Diuretics: When to Use Them
Diuretics like furosemide can reduce leg circumference by 2.5cm in just 6 hours. They work by helping the body eliminate excess fluid. However, they are best used for short-term relief, typically less than 72 hours.
Diuretics may increase fall risk by 22% in wheelchair users. They can also affect blood pressure, making them unsuitable for patients with orthostatic hypotension. Always consult a doctor before starting diuretics.

Monitoring and Managing Skin Health
Maintaining healthy skin is essential for those with limited mobility. Swelling in the legs can increase the risk of skin issues. Daily care and inspections are key to preventing complications.
Daily Skin Inspections
Regular skin checks help identify early signs of trouble. Use a mirror to inspect hard-to-see areas like the ankles and heels. Mirror-assisted inspections find three times more lesions than visual checks alone.
Follow a 5-step protocol for thorough inspections:
- Check for changes in color or redness.
- Feel for temperature differences.
- Assess texture for roughness or swelling.
- Note any unusual sensations like pain or tingling.
- Look for excessive moisture or dryness.
High-risk zones include the malleoli, heels, and metatarsals. Make sure to inspect these areas carefully.
Preventing Pressure Ulcers
Pressure ulcers often develop in areas with fluid legs. Using pH-balanced cleansers can reduce the risk of skin breakdown by 45%. Apply moisture barriers to protect sensitive skin.
Prophylactic dressings are helpful in high-pressure areas. Schedule pressure mapping every six months to identify risk zones. Make sure to address any issues promptly to avoid complications.
